XL 2010 Liste filtrée pour combobox à 1 ou x colonne(s) (Titre màj)

cathodique

XLDnaute Barbatruc
Bonjour,

Je fais appel aux férus de VBA (pas comme moi, Vbiste autodidacte du dimanche).

Au fil de mes recherches j'ai trouvé dans les ressources un fichier de @Dudu2 (ICI) très pratique.

Je voudrai appliquer son code à plusieurs ComboBox. Mais je ne sais pas utilisé les modules de classe.

J'ai pourtant suivi des tutos en vidéo (l'anglais n'étant pas mon fort) sans comprendre grand chose.

Dernièrement, @patricktoulon a eu la gentillesse de corriger un code trouver sur le net et a dédié une vidéo pour expliquer ce que sont les modules de Classe. J'ai compris dans l'ensemble le principe. Mais ça coince toujours lors de l'écriture du code. Petite cervelle restera petite cervelle😢😢

Je ne joins pas de fichier, vous le trouverez en suivant le lien.

Je vous en remercie par avance.

Bon dimanche.

nb: j'ai envoyé à @Dudu2 pour l'informer
 
Dernière édition:
Solution
re
oui j'ai fais cette erreur jean-marie a corrigé
je vous lais éviter de repasser tout les items en revu en cas de grande liste
perso je corrigerais comme ça
VB:
For i = .ListCount - 1 To Application.Max(.ListCount - 3, 0) Step -1
tout ton code et tes controls fonctionnent dans mon userform

cathodique

XLDnaute Barbatruc
Bonjour,
Lorsqu'il n'y a qu'un seul item pour la liste de la ComboBox ça ne plante pas.

@Dudu2 : Je te confirme que le code plante, lorsqu'il n'y a qu'une ligne dans le tableau.
à moins que j'ai mal adapté ton code (juste modifier nom tableau et combo)
Tableau.JPG
Ligne bug.JPG

erreur.JPG


Bonne journée.
 

cathodique

XLDnaute Barbatruc
Bonjour,
Mais d'où sort ce code ?
Ce n'est pas du code présent dans la ressource.
Quelle ressource as-tu utilisée et qu'as-tu modifié ?
Bonjour,

J'ai fait une rechercher sur Google, un lien m'a fait aboutir sur XLD et j'ai téléchargé le fichier ci-joint.
J'espère que c'est ton fichier (sur lequel, j'ai ajouté un tableau vide).
 

Pièces jointes

  • Saisie assistée ComboBox.xlsm
    86.1 KB · Affichages: 1

cathodique

XLDnaute Barbatruc
A aucun moment il est dit que le code de la ressource doit être modifié.
Je n'ai pas voulu le modifier, j'ai voulu l'adapter à mon besoin.
Cependant, il me semble que ce forum est dédié à l'entraide et au partage.
J'abandonne l'utilisation de ta ressource. Je trouverai bien une autre solution.

Je m'excuse de t'avoir dérangé. Je te promets que ça ne se reproduira plus
Bonne journée.
 
Dernière édition:

Statistiques des forums

Discussions
312 459
Messages
2 088 577
Membres
103 884
dernier inscrit
simon.corpataux